Description: The project is in Laos, in the Phu Khao Khuai Mountains. The new project focuses on teaching English to villagers, adults, guides and also children/teachers in two villages where eco tourists will go trekking, stay with a host family etc.

The project is situated in the Water Buffalo Mountains, a national park about a 2 hour drive from Vientiane, the capital of Laos. This region has been restricted and unavailable for tourists until now.

Phu Khao Khuai, the Water Buffalo Mountains. Bordering on the Vientiane Province, the region has been the least visited area in Laos. Home to secret US bases during the Vietnam war, it was a "special zone". It has recently been opened for tourism though travel is still restricted.

Highlights: Exciting to explore, very sparsely populated, heavily forested and with an interesting wildlife such a clouded leopards, wild elephants, sun bears, net pythons. The Nam Ngum river offers exciting world class rapids in stunning forest and mountain scenery and upstream some of the last remaining (in the wild) Siamese crocodiles may be found.

Openmind projects volunteers will contribute to improving the lives of the local and isolated population, mainly ethnic Lao Loum and Hmong people, and to preserving untouched nature.

Open mind projects's Mission Statement: Open Mind Projects is a bridge to knowledge and cross-cultural understanding, bridging digital and knowledge divides between rich and poor. Open Mind Projects arranges placements for international volunteers to schools, Orphan Homes, other institutions and projects, in Thailand and Laos. Open Mind Projects cooperates with these schools and institutions with learning ideas, technology and international volunteers. Schools and other learning/youth institutions in developing nations are understaffed and under resources. New information technology and international volunteers help offset this advantage. Open Mind Projects wants to facilitate valuable cross-cultural experience, personal development, for volunteers and local childeren and students.
